Pre-School


This is a period of dramatic growth and transformation.  Emphasis is on physical growth and independence, the concrete world and the construction of the self as the center of things in a sensory-motor, factual, protected environment.  The young child is capable of taking in great amounts of knowledge through the senses.

The central question is “What is it?”
The overriding desire is to “Let me do it myself!”

 

The half-day Pre-School class is available for children between two and one-half and four years of age.  The class meets five days a week for two hours and thirty minutes, in both morning and afternoon sessions. 
The morning session is from 8:30AM - 11:00AM. 
The afternoon session is from 12:30PM - 3:00PM.

The Pre-School Program focuses on:

  • Practical Life
    • includes: Care of Self and the Environment, Gross and Fine Motor Skills, Social Development
  • Sensorial
  • Language
    • Utilizing a Phonetic Approach to Reading
  • Math
  • Cultural
    • includes: Geography, Science and History
  • Introduction to Art Mediums
  • Music
  • Spanish
